Understanding the root causes helps you tackle the issue effectively:
1. GPS Signal Interference
Urban environments, dense foliage, or indoor settings can block GPS satellites, preventing location tracking even if services are enabled.
2. Location Services Disabled or Misconfigured
If Location Services are toggled off in Settings > Privacy & Security > Location Services, the device refuses to report location data, resulting in “No Location Found.”
3. Software Glitches
Buggy iOS updates or corrupted system files sometimes disrupt core location frameworks (CoreLocation), creating intermittent or missing data.
4. Hardware Limitations
Some iPhones with aging chips or dual-band band Antennas may have intermittent GPS performance, especially under extreme environmental conditions.
